Compartir a través de


FromSqlExpression Constructores

Definición

Sobrecargas

FromSqlExpression(ITableBase, String, Expression)

Crea una nueva instancia de la clase FromSqlExpression.

FromSqlExpression(String, Expression, String)
Obsoletos.

Crea una nueva instancia de la clase FromSqlExpression.

FromSqlExpression(String, String, Expression)

Crea una nueva instancia de la clase FromSqlExpression.

FromSqlExpression(ITableBase, String, Expression)

Crea una nueva instancia de la clase FromSqlExpression.

public FromSqlExpression (Microsoft.EntityFrameworkCore.Metadata.ITableBase defaultTableBase, string sql, System.Linq.Expressions.Expression arguments);
new Microsoft.EntityFrameworkCore.Query.SqlExpressions.FromSqlExpression : Microsoft.EntityFrameworkCore.Metadata.ITableBase * string * System.Linq.Expressions.Expression -> Microsoft.EntityFrameworkCore.Query.SqlExpressions.FromSqlExpression
Public Sub New (defaultTableBase As ITableBase, sql As String, arguments As Expression)

Parámetros

defaultTableBase
ITableBase

Base de tabla predeterminada asociada a este origen de tabla.

sql
String

SQL personalizado proporcionado por el usuario para el origen de la tabla.

arguments
Expression

Parámetros proporcionados por el usuario que se van a pasar a SQL personalizado.

Se aplica a

FromSqlExpression(String, Expression, String)

Precaución

Use the constructor which takes alias as first argument.

Crea una nueva instancia de la clase FromSqlExpression.

public FromSqlExpression (string sql, System.Linq.Expressions.Expression arguments, string alias);
[System.Obsolete("Use the constructor which takes alias as first argument.")]
public FromSqlExpression (string sql, System.Linq.Expressions.Expression arguments, string alias);
new Microsoft.EntityFrameworkCore.Query.SqlExpressions.FromSqlExpression : string * System.Linq.Expressions.Expression * string -> Microsoft.EntityFrameworkCore.Query.SqlExpressions.FromSqlExpression
[<System.Obsolete("Use the constructor which takes alias as first argument.")>]
new Microsoft.EntityFrameworkCore.Query.SqlExpressions.FromSqlExpression : string * System.Linq.Expressions.Expression * string -> Microsoft.EntityFrameworkCore.Query.SqlExpressions.FromSqlExpression
Public Sub New (sql As String, arguments As Expression, alias As String)

Parámetros

sql
String

SQL personalizado proporcionado por el usuario para el origen de la tabla.

arguments
Expression

Parámetros proporcionados por el usuario que se van a pasar a SQL personalizado.

alias
String

Alias de cadena para el origen de la tabla.

Atributos

Se aplica a

FromSqlExpression(String, String, Expression)

Crea una nueva instancia de la clase FromSqlExpression.

public FromSqlExpression (string alias, string sql, System.Linq.Expressions.Expression arguments);
new Microsoft.EntityFrameworkCore.Query.SqlExpressions.FromSqlExpression : string * string * System.Linq.Expressions.Expression -> Microsoft.EntityFrameworkCore.Query.SqlExpressions.FromSqlExpression
Public Sub New (alias As String, sql As String, arguments As Expression)

Parámetros

alias
String

Alias que se va a usar para este origen de tabla.

sql
String

SQL personalizado proporcionado por el usuario para el origen de la tabla.

arguments
Expression

Parámetros proporcionados por el usuario que se van a pasar a SQL personalizado.

Se aplica a